In an exciting development for the hospitality sector, the Government has announced a fast-track review aimed at overhauling outdated licensing regulations that have long hindered the growth and vibrancy of pubs, bars, and community events across the nation. This initiative underscores a commitment to fostering a thriving social scene, allowing businesses to better serve their communities and adapt to the evolving landscape of leisure and entertainment.
For years, many landlords and operators have voiced their frustrations regarding rigid licensing laws that seem more suited to an era long past than to the dynamic and varied needs of today’s society. The existing regulations often restrict not only the operational hours of venues but also the types of events that can be hosted. This has created barriers for landlords who wish to innovate and diversify their offerings, ultimately limiting the potential for community engagement and economic growth.
The Government’s intention to solicit feedback directly from those who are most affected—landlords, patrons, and local residents—marks a refreshing approach to policy-making. This engagement is crucial, as it ensures that the voices of those with firsthand experience at the coalface are heard. Landlords, who understand the nuances of their establishments and clientele, will be instrumental in shaping a framework that balances public safety with the need for flexibility and creativity in operations.
